R v North Thames Regional Health Authority, ex parte L

(1996) 7 Med LR 385

QUEEN'S BENCH DIVISION, CROWN OFFICE LIST

and Mr Justice SEDLEY

National Health Service — Disciplinary functions — Responsibility — Doctors' “honorary” clinical contracts — Whether binding contracts of employment — Whether primary or delegated legislation effected transfer of doctors' employment from Regional Health Authority (RHA) to NHS Trusts — Whether patient making complaint through his father had sufficient interest to challenge legality or rationality of decisions taken by RHA not to bring disciplinary proceedings against doctors — Whether employment which doctors had under honorary clinical contract with NHS Trust was continuation in law of antecedent contractual relationship with RHA — Whether NHS Trust had power in law to delegate discharge of its disciplinary function back to RHA
